Transaction 18d8cd3eb363fa1560c2c690e9550495980b5401558fcfd94c06cb48e8e2dea7

1 Input
2 Outputs
  • 18d8cd3eb363fa1560c2c690e9550495980b5401558fcfd94c06cb48e8e2dea7:0
  • value  210133
    address  3R13ZBCioV9PRMKVdsdjoG37opnpkUXy5r
  • 18d8cd3eb363fa1560c2c690e9550495980b5401558fcfd94c06cb48e8e2dea7:1
  • value  3006247
    address  33iWTZcW2UxPKFheF6QmSRL3ASpYhDGWSh